Frigid Zone is an area lying between the Arctic Circle and the North Pole in the Northern Hemisphere and the Antarctic Circle and the South Pole in the Southern Hemisphere, are very cold.

The subtropical high pressure belt is often called horse latitude. It is situated around 30o Northern and Southern hemisphere.

Stratus cloud often look like thin, white sheets covering the whole sky. Since they are so thin, they seldom produce much rain or snow. Sometimes, in the mountains or hills, these clouds appear to be fog.

Rain is the most widespread and most important form of liquid precipitation. its water droplets are large, usually over 0.5mm in diameter.
